India enters the five-match series on the back of a ODI World Cup final loss against Australia, where the Men in Blue suffered a six-wicket defeat. Moreover, where the T20 World Cup just six months away, India and Australia will lock horns in a five-match series starting November 23.
This eagerly anticipated, high-voltage clash promises to be a spectacle of cricketing prowess, with both teams fiercely determined to make their mark in the finals.
November 23: First T20, Visakhapatnam
November 26: Second T20, Thiruvananthapuram
November 28: Third T20, Guwahati
December 1: Fourth T20, Raipur
December 3: Fifth T20, Bengaluru
All the much-anticipated and high-voltage clash between India vs Australia T20 games will begin at 7 PM IST. The toss will start half an hour earlier from the scheduled time.
The T20I series between India vs Australia will broadcast on Jio Cinema, Sports 18 and Colors Cineplex
India’s squad: Suryakumar Yadav (Captain), Ruturaj Gaikwad (vice-captain), Ishan Kishan, Yashasvi Jaiswal, Tilak Varma, Rinku Singh, Jitesh Sharma (wk), Washington Sundar, Axar Patel, Shivam Dubey, Ravi Bishnoi, Arshdeep Singh, Prasidh Krishna, Avesh Khan, Mukesh Kumar
Australia squad: Matthew Wade (Captain), Aaron Hardie, Jason Behrendorff, Sean Abbott, Tim David, Nathan Ellis, Travis Head, Josh Inglis, Glenn Maxwell, Tanveer Sangha, Matt Short, Steve Smith, Marcus Stoinis, Kane Richardson, Adam Zampa.
